+#ifdef HAVE_CONFIG_H
+#include "config.h"
+#endif
+
+/* project specific includes */
+#include <jtag/interface.h>
+#include <jtag/tcl.h>
+#include <transport/transport.h>
+#include <target/target.h>
+#include <jtag/aice/aice_interface.h>
+#include <jtag/aice/aice_transport.h>
+
+/* */
+static int jim_newtap_expected_id(Jim_Nvp *n, Jim_GetOptInfo *goi,
+               struct jtag_tap *pTap)
+{
+       jim_wide w;
+       int e = Jim_GetOpt_Wide(goi, &w);
+       if (e != JIM_OK) {
+               Jim_SetResultFormatted(goi->interp, "option: %s bad parameter",
+                               n->name);
+               return e;
+       }
+
+       unsigned expected_len = sizeof(uint32_t) * pTap->expected_ids_cnt;
+       uint32_t *new_expected_ids = malloc(expected_len + sizeof(uint32_t));
+       if (new_expected_ids == NULL) {
+               Jim_SetResultFormatted(goi->interp, "no memory");
+               return JIM_ERR;
+       }
+
+       memcpy(new_expected_ids, pTap->expected_ids, expected_len);
+
+       new_expected_ids[pTap->expected_ids_cnt] = w;
+
+       free(pTap->expected_ids);
+       pTap->expected_ids = new_expected_ids;
+       pTap->expected_ids_cnt++;
+
+       return JIM_OK;
+}
+
+#define NTAP_OPT_EXPECTED_ID 0
+
+/* */
+static int jim_aice_newtap_cmd(Jim_GetOptInfo *goi)
+{
+       struct jtag_tap *pTap;
+       int x;
+       int e;
+       Jim_Nvp *n;
+       char *cp;
+       const Jim_Nvp opts[] = {
+               {.name = "-expected-id", .value = NTAP_OPT_EXPECTED_ID},
+               {.name = NULL, .value = -1},
+       };
+
+       pTap = calloc(1, sizeof(struct jtag_tap));
+       if (!pTap) {
+               Jim_SetResultFormatted(goi->interp, "no memory");
+               return JIM_ERR;
+       }
+
+       /*
+        * we expect CHIP + TAP + OPTIONS
+        * */
+       if (goi->argc < 3) {
+               Jim_SetResultFormatted(goi->interp,
+                               "Missing CHIP TAP OPTIONS ....");
+               free(pTap);
+               return JIM_ERR;
+       }
+       Jim_GetOpt_String(goi, &cp, NULL);
+       pTap->chip = strdup(cp);
+
+       Jim_GetOpt_String(goi, &cp, NULL);
+       pTap->tapname = strdup(cp);
+
+       /* name + dot + name + null */
+       x = strlen(pTap->chip) + 1 + strlen(pTap->tapname) + 1;
+       cp = malloc(x);
+       sprintf(cp, "%s.%s", pTap->chip, pTap->tapname);
+       pTap->dotted_name = cp;
+
+       LOG_DEBUG("Creating New Tap, Chip: %s, Tap: %s, Dotted: %s, %d params",
+                       pTap->chip, pTap->tapname, pTap->dotted_name, goi->argc);
+
+       while (goi->argc) {
+               e = Jim_GetOpt_Nvp(goi, opts, &n);
+               if (e != JIM_OK) {
+                       Jim_GetOpt_NvpUnknown(goi, opts, 0);
+                       free((void *)pTap->dotted_name);
+                       free(pTap);
+                       return e;
+               }
+               LOG_DEBUG("Processing option: %s", n->name);
+               switch (n->value) {
+                       case NTAP_OPT_EXPECTED_ID:
+                               e = jim_newtap_expected_id(n, goi, pTap);
+                               if (JIM_OK != e) {
+                                       free((void *)pTap->dotted_name);
+                                       free(pTap);
+                                       return e;
+                               }
+                               break;
+               }               /* switch (n->value) */
+       }                       /* while (goi->argc) */
+
+       /* default is enabled-after-reset */
+       pTap->enabled = !pTap->disabled_after_reset;
+
+       jtag_tap_init(pTap);
+       return JIM_OK;
+}
+
+/* */
+static int jim_aice_newtap(Jim_Interp *interp, int argc, Jim_Obj * const *argv)
+{
+       Jim_GetOptInfo goi;
+       Jim_GetOpt_Setup(&goi, interp, argc - 1, argv + 1);
+       return jim_aice_newtap_cmd(&goi);
+}
+
+/* */
+COMMAND_HANDLER(handle_aice_init_command)
+{
+       if (CMD_ARGC != 0)
+               return ERROR_COMMAND_SYNTAX_ERROR;
+
+       static bool jtag_initialized;
+       if (jtag_initialized) {
+               LOG_INFO("'jtag init' has already been called");
+               return ERROR_OK;
+       }
+       jtag_initialized = true;
+
+       LOG_DEBUG("Initializing jtag devices...");
+       return jtag_init(CMD_CTX);
+}
+
+static int jim_aice_arp_init(Jim_Interp *interp, int argc, Jim_Obj * const *argv)
+{
+       LOG_DEBUG("No implement: jim_aice_arp_init");
+
+       return JIM_OK;
+}
+
+/* */
+static int aice_init_reset(struct command_context *cmd_ctx)
+{
+       LOG_DEBUG("Initializing with hard TRST+SRST reset");
+
+       int retval;
+       enum reset_types jtag_reset_config = jtag_get_reset_config();
+
+       jtag_add_reset(1, 0);   /* TAP_RESET */
+       if (jtag_reset_config & RESET_HAS_SRST) {
+               jtag_add_reset(1, 1);
+               if ((jtag_reset_config & RESET_SRST_PULLS_TRST) == 0)
+                       jtag_add_reset(0, 1);
+       }
+       jtag_add_reset(0, 0);
+       retval = jtag_execute_queue();
+       if (retval != ERROR_OK)
+               return retval;
+
+       return ERROR_OK;
+}
+
+/* */
+static int jim_aice_arp_init_reset(Jim_Interp *interp, int argc, Jim_Obj * const *argv)
+{
+       int e = ERROR_OK;
+       Jim_GetOptInfo goi;
+       Jim_GetOpt_Setup(&goi, interp, argc - 1, argv + 1);
+       if (goi.argc != 0) {
+               Jim_WrongNumArgs(goi.interp, 1, goi.argv - 1, "(no params)");
+               return JIM_ERR;
+       }
+       struct command_context *context = current_command_context(interp);
+       e = aice_init_reset(context);
+
+       if (e != ERROR_OK) {
+               Jim_Obj *eObj = Jim_NewIntObj(goi.interp, e);
+               Jim_SetResultFormatted(goi.interp, "error: %#s", eObj);
+               Jim_FreeNewObj(goi.interp, eObj);
+               return JIM_ERR;
+       }
+       return JIM_OK;
+}
+
+static int jim_aice_names(Jim_Interp *interp, int argc, Jim_Obj *const *argv)
+{
+       Jim_GetOptInfo goi;
+       Jim_GetOpt_Setup(&goi, interp, argc - 1, argv + 1);
+       if (goi.argc != 0) {
+               Jim_WrongNumArgs(goi.interp, 1, goi.argv, "Too many parameters");
+               return JIM_ERR;
+       }
+       Jim_SetResult(goi.interp, Jim_NewListObj(goi.interp, NULL, 0));
+       struct jtag_tap *tap;
+
+       for (tap = jtag_all_taps(); tap; tap = tap->next_tap)
+               Jim_ListAppendElement(goi.interp,
+                               Jim_GetResult(goi.interp),
+                               Jim_NewStringObj(goi.interp,
+                                       tap->dotted_name, -1));
+
+       return JIM_OK;
+}
+
+/* */
+static const struct command_registration
+aice_transport_jtag_subcommand_handlers[] = {
+       {
+               .name = "init",
+               .mode = COMMAND_ANY,
+               .handler = handle_aice_init_command,
+               .help = "initialize jtag scan chain",
+               .usage = ""
+       },
+       {
+               .name = "arp_init",
+               .mode = COMMAND_ANY,
+               .jim_handler = jim_aice_arp_init,
+               .help = "Validates JTAG scan chain against the list of "
+                       "declared TAPs.",
+       },
+       {
+               .name = "arp_init-reset",
+               .mode = COMMAND_ANY,
+               .jim_handler = jim_aice_arp_init_reset,
+               .help = "Uses TRST and SRST to try resetting everything on "
+                       "the JTAG scan chain, then performs 'jtag arp_init'."
+       },
+       {
+               .name = "newtap",
+               .mode = COMMAND_CONFIG,
+               .jim_handler = jim_aice_newtap,
+               .help = "Create a new TAP instance named basename.tap_type, "
+                       "and appends it to the scan chain.",
+               .usage = "basename tap_type ['-expected_id' number]"
+       },
+       {
+               .name = "tapisenabled",
+               .mode = COMMAND_EXEC,
+               .jim_handler = jim_jtag_tap_enabler,
+               .help = "Returns a Tcl boolean (0/1) indicating whether "
+                       "the TAP is enabled (1) or not (0).",
+               .usage = "tap_name",
+       },
+       {
+               .name = "tapenable",
+               .mode = COMMAND_EXEC,
+               .jim_handler = jim_jtag_tap_enabler,
+               .help = "Try to enable the specified TAP using the "
+                       "'tap-enable' TAP event.",
+               .usage = "tap_name",
+       },
+       {
+               .name = "tapdisable",
+               .mode = COMMAND_EXEC,
+               .jim_handler = jim_jtag_tap_enabler,
+               .help = "Try to disable the specified TAP using the "
+                       "'tap-disable' TAP event.",
+               .usage = "tap_name",
+       },
+       {
+               .name = "configure",
+               .mode = COMMAND_EXEC,
+               .jim_handler = jim_jtag_configure,
+               .help = "Provide a Tcl handler for the specified "
+                       "TAP event.",
+               .usage = "tap_name '-event' event_name handler",
+       },
+       {
+               .name = "cget",
+               .mode = COMMAND_EXEC,
+               .jim_handler = jim_jtag_configure,
+               .help = "Return any Tcl handler for the specified "
+                       "TAP event.",
+               .usage = "tap_name '-event' event_name",
+       },
+       {
+               .name = "names",
+               .mode = COMMAND_ANY,
+               .jim_handler = jim_aice_names,
+               .help = "Returns list of all JTAG tap names.",
+       },
+
+       COMMAND_REGISTRATION_DONE
+};
+
+/* */
+static const struct command_registration aice_transport_command_handlers[] = {
+       {
+               .name = "jtag",
+               .mode = COMMAND_ANY,
+               .usage = "",
+               .chain = aice_transport_jtag_subcommand_handlers,
+       },
+       COMMAND_REGISTRATION_DONE
+
+};
+
+/* */
+static int aice_transport_register_commands(struct command_context *cmd_ctx)
+{
+       return register_commands(cmd_ctx, NULL,
+                       aice_transport_command_handlers);
+}
+
+/* */
+static int aice_transport_init(struct command_context *cmd_ctx)
+{
+       LOG_DEBUG("aice_transport_init");
+       struct target *t = get_current_target(cmd_ctx);
+       struct transport *transport;
+
+       if (!t) {
+               LOG_ERROR("no current target");
+               return ERROR_FAIL;
+       }
+
+       transport = get_current_transport();
+
+       if (!transport) {
+               LOG_ERROR("no transport selected");
+               return ERROR_FAIL;
+       }
+
+       LOG_DEBUG("current transport %s", transport->name);
+
+       return aice_init_target(t);
+}
+
+/* */
+static int aice_transport_select(struct command_context *ctx)
+{
+       LOG_DEBUG("aice_transport_select");
+
+       int retval;
+
+       retval = aice_transport_register_commands(ctx);
+
+       if (retval != ERROR_OK)
+               return retval;
+
+       return ERROR_OK;
+}
+
+static struct transport aice_jtag_transport = {
+       .name = "aice_jtag",
+       .select = aice_transport_select,
+       .init = aice_transport_init,
+};
+
+const char *aice_transports[] = { "aice_jtag", NULL };
+
+static void aice_constructor(void) __attribute__((constructor));
+static void aice_constructor(void)
+{
+       transport_register(&aice_jtag_transport);
+}
